The structure that forms a bony bulge on the distal, lateral surface of the lower leg is the ________.

Biology
1 answer:
sveticcg [70]3 years ago
7 0
The lateral malleolus found on the distal lateral surface of the fibula is responsible for the bony bulge on the lower leg. 

The lateral malleolus is the prominence on the outer or lateral side of the ankle. It is pyramidal in form and somewhat flattened. In clinical significance, a bimalleolar fracture is an ankle fracture that involves both the medial and lateral malleolus. This condition is more common in women especially the 60 year old age group. Another clinical condition of the said anatomical structure is the trimalleolar fracture which involves the lateral, medial, and the distal posterior aspect of the tibia or the posterior malleolus. This is primarily caused by ligament damage and dislocation.

Organs _____.
maksim [4K]

Answer:

perform functions that tissues cannot carry out on their own

Explanation:

In the hierarchy of living system organs come after tissues and before organ systems. Hence, organs are complex then tissues and perform functions that tissues wont be able to perform on their own.

A organ is made up of various types of tissues. They can be divided into two categories, main tissue and sporadic tissue. Main tissue or parenchyma is unique to that organ and defines the function of the organ. For example: Cortex and medulla together form the main functional tissue in kidney. Similarly, myocardium is the main tissue of the heart. Sporadic tissue has blood vessels, nerves and connective tissues.

What sequence correctly describes the route that an egg takes through the female reproductive system? (2 points). A.Cervix – fal
Charra [1.4K]
The sequence that correctly describes the route that an egg takes through the female reproductive system would be option d. Ovary - Fallopian tube - Uterus. The mature egg is released by the ovary into the Fallopian Tube. Once it is fertilized, it is embedded in the wall of the uterus and this is where the unborn baby develops. If fertilization does not happen, the endometrium is broken down, which results in menstruation.
